On Wed, Feb 6, 2013 at 11:53 AM, Philip Bromiley <bromiley@uci.edu> wrote: > I find myself wanting influence statistics (Cook's d etc.) when I am doing panel data analyses. The way I've been doing it is running regressions with dummy variables to generate influence statistics and then using those in an xtreg or similar analysis. > > It would be very nice if xtreg predict could produce influence statistics.
